DONNA ZAGOTTA AWS, NWS

Image
Active professionally for more than 20 years, Donna Zagotta is an internationally recognized painter, teacher, and juror. She is a signature member of the American Watercolor Society and the National Watercolor Society.  Her paintings have evolved from an early emphasis on traditional watercolor techniques and traditionally influenced realism to an unconventional use of the watercolor medium and the exploration of that area that lies between realism and abstraction.  Donna has a passion for art history with a special interest in Modernism and finds inspiration in the work of Edouard Vuillard, Henri Matisse, and Richard Diebenkorn, master painters who were more focused on expressing color and spatial ideas than on rendering the particulars of subject matter. JANSEN CHOW AWS, NWS

Image
Jansen Chow is a signature member of American Watercolor Society (AWS) and National Watercolor Society (NWS).  He won an art scholarship and studied in The Art Students League of New York, New York from 1994-1996 and he also a student of Mario Cooper, a great America Watercolor Master.  Jansen has held 16 solo art exhibitions and took part in more than 300 national and international watercolor exhibitions since 1992.  He has won more than 60 national & International awards in oil, watercolor, photography & etching since 1988 including receiving 1st place 9 times in watercolor competitions in the USA, Canada, Turkey & Malaysia. Recently he is IWS Malaysia Country Head,   FabrianoInAcquarello Malaysia Country Leader and the curator of “1st Malaysia International Watercolor Biennale 2018”.

LINDA BAKER AWS DF, NWS

Image
‘Capturing the extraordinary light that transforms a subject almost to abstraction is a main objective in creating my watercolors'-says International award winning watercolorist Linda Daly Baker, aws-df, nws.  As a full-time professional artist, she has created originals, reproduced a line of giclees’ and has two instructional videos available through Creative Catalyst Productions. Along with her paintings, she has taught workshops world-wide and is a sought after juror. Her paintings appear in many publications including Masters of Watercolor by Konstantin Sterkhov and the North Light Splash series.  Her honors include the Shenzhen Biennials, Qindao Invitational, American Watercolor Society, National Watercolor Society, the San Diego International, and most recently earned her Dolphin Fellow in the prestigious American Watercolor Society. ANDY EVANSEN AWS

Image
Andy Evansen’s interest in art started in childhood, as he can’t recall a time when he wasn’t drawing. He began painting watercolors in the mid 1990s as a change of pace from his career as a medical illustrator. Choosing a ‘style’ was not difficult, as Andy was always inspired by the watercolor paintings of British artists Trevor Chamberlain, David Curtis, Ed Seago and John Yardley, among others. He found himself attempting to capture the landscape with the same economy of brushstroke, taking advantage of the luminosity of watercolors done in just a few washes. In addition, he was impressed with the way those artists seemed to capture everyday scenes in such a way that revealed a hidden beauty, subjects that many would simply pass by. His work gained recognition after winning an international watercolor competition through American Artist magazine, appearing on their cover in 2005. LAURIE GOLDSTEIN WARREN

Image
Originally from New York, Laurie now lives in West Virginia.   She has been painting watercolors for the last 19 years.    Laurie continues to experiment with new techniques in watercolor and watercolor/acrylic.    She has exhibited her work in the U.S., Japan, Turkey, Greece, Canada and China.   Currently, she travels and teaches workshops across the United States.   Her works focus on cityscapes, portraits and still life.  She has been published in Watercolor Artist Magazine several times and last year her work earned the High Winds Medal Award at the 150th anniversary of the American Watercolor Society Exhibition.

ROBERT O' BRIEN AWS, NWS

Image
Robert J. O’Brien is a full time award winning artist and popular local, national and international workshop instructor.  He is a signature member of the American, National and New England Watercolor Societies, among others.   He recently received the Mary Bryan Memorial Award at the 68th Academic Artists National Exhibition in Vernon, Connecticut and the Joseph Santoro Memorial Award at the New England Watercolor Society’s 2018 Juried Signature Members Show in Boston. In 2017 he won the Combined Donors Award 1 at the 97th International Exhibition of the National Watercolor Society in San Pedro CA. He also won the Gurdon and Mildred Evans Memorial Award at the 36th Adirondacks National Exhibition of American Watercolors. He was accepted into the 147th, 148th, 149th, 150th and in 2018, the 151stth International Exhibition of the American Watercolor Society, held at the Salmagundi Club in New York, NY.
